George W. Bush to speak Monday at Vanderbilt University

NASHVILLE, Tenn. (AP) — Former President George W. Bush is slated to speak at Vanderbilt University as part of a lecture series.

The university says the 43rd president will be joined on stage Monday evening by Vanderbilt Chancellor Nicholas Zeppos and presidential historian Jon Meacham.

A limited number of free tickets for the event were given out only to Vanderbilt students, faculty and staff based on a random drawing. A university spokesman said the event is closed to the press.

substitute 'chicken hawk' in place of 'draft dodger' and then I agree with everything but every time 'draft dodger' is used as an attack on someone's character I feel a correction is needed.
Just like Mr. Five Deferments Cheney, GW Bush is a 'chicken hawk',or someone that promote wars but won't fight in them but when it comes to 'draft dodgers' I'm proud to have been one and wish hundreds of thousands of others had done the same thing which would've been a gift of life to a lot of the people in SE Asia.

I lived in Nelson,a small town in British Columbia Canada and the nearby Slocan Valley was nicknamed 'little America valley' because of so many people that were dodging the draft moved there and there were groups trying to help others get into Canada.
I gotta add that getting across the line into Canada was pretty damn easy in rural areas, in fact me my girlfriend and her three year old boy simply walked thru the woods into Canada hiked to the highway and hitched into Vancouver. There I met many other 'Americans' there for the same reason before moving to Nelson and meeting all those 'draft dodgers', very good people with a conscience that were not going to support the warmongering.
In other words people felt no one should participate in the killing and some sent money to people in prison for evading the draft.

Enough of that rant, but I will add this...in Slocan Valley they built homes with the collective help from others in the Valley, just like in building the 'community center' but for many it was considered a temporary situation.There was a general feeling that the war would end one day and the talk about returning without the threat of prison would eventually happen.
Which Jimmy Carter did (to some degree) but many had other charges still in effect in the States (usually drug related) to which they'd refused to 'plea bargain' away by joining the army,so until the statute of limitations expired on them they couldn't return.
But now many years later the majority of them are still there, having become citizens of Canada, and their children have grown up and had children so in the end, war or no war, the chose to remain in Canada.
A lesser know fact about that time period... there were so many Americans living, illegally, in Canada that one day I heard on the radio an announcement from the govt. about a program called "make our Country your Country"(or something close to that). Just make yourself known to the govt. and unless one was fleeing prosecution for certain crimes it was apparently a rubber stamp approval.A lot of people jumped at the chance and I didn't go in only because I didn't think any Country would be that considerate, I thought it might be a trap, but one thing was evident to anyone paying attention Canada respected 'draft dodgers'.
